LT10.7M Ceramic Filters for FM Receiver
Ceramic Filters for FM Receiver
(LT10.7M) Ceramic Filters are Compatible Murata SFELF10M7
Preview Token LT10.7M series are monolithic devices whichutilize the energy-trapped thickness vibration-mode. This principle of operation is based upon the fact that an excellent resonating element with low spurious vibration can be obtained by adhering to certain theoretical parameters of design. These parameters include the physical dimensions of the peizo element, the electrode pattern, and the associated mass loading effect of the electrodes. Token categorizes the LT 10.7 family according to rank of center frequency. This ranking indicates that a given LT 10.7 will be marked with one of the colors listed in the following chart and will exhibit the center frequency in Technical Characteristics Table. The LT10.7M offers three series: LT10.7M for FM Receiver (Compatible Murata SFELF10M7), LT10.7M A10 Insertion Loss 2.52.0 db ~ 4.52.0 db (Compatible Murata SFELF10M7 A10), and LT10.7M Wide Band-width 950 kHz at 20dB/Narrow Band-width 95 kHz at 20dB (Compatible Murata SFELF10M7 DBS Receiver). LT10.7M Narrow Band-width series features stable low spurious and temperature characteristics. This series is suitable for European car-audio or AM up conversion use that needs narrow band characteristics are stable. LT10.7M Wide Band-width series are specified to make up conventional ceramic filters which wider band characteristics not obtained. Custom parts are available on request. Token will also produce devices outside these specifications to meet specific customer requirements, please contact our sales for more information. Applications - Change in center frequency is typically within 30ppm/C at -20C to +80C. - Various band widths are available for applications in wide to narrow bands. - Low loss, favorable waveform symmetry, and high selectivity. - These miniature filters have high mechanical strength. - Excellent shape factor of frequency response. - Small dispersion and stable characteristics. - Good waveform symmetry. - High reliability. 1. When using ceramic filters, it is most important to match the input/output load to impedance 330 ohm (LT10.7MA19 is 470 ohm matching). Waveform symmetry is damaged when reactance is added to the input/output load. 2. Two ceramic filters directly connected can be used for high selectivity. For reducing waveform variation, it is recommended to input a buffer AMP between ceramic filters. 3. The LT10.7M series are of input/output symmetric structure so that in theory there is no input/output directionality. Actual circuits may use different input/output loading conditions (for example, mismatched impedance) or capacitance load. In such cases, the waveform will be a little changed by the direction of the input/output of the ceramic filters.
